Commercial Slab Construction in Cumming, GA
Commercial slab construction services involve the preparation and pouring of concrete slabs that serve as the foundation for various types of commercial buildings, including warehouses, retail spaces, office complexes, and industrial facilities. These services typically cover site preparation, formwork, reinforcement, and concrete pouring to create durable, level surfaces essential for the structural integrity of a building. Property owners often seek this service when developing new commercial properties or expanding existing facilities, ensuring the foundation is built to support heavy loads and withstand environmental conditions common in the Cumming, GA area.
Before requesting commercial slab construction, property owners usually want to understand the scope of work, including site requirements, soil conditions, and any necessary permits or regulations. Clarifying the project's size, intended use, and timeline helps ensure the process aligns with overall construction plans. Additionally, understanding the materials used and the quality standards maintained during construction can contribute to a successful outcome, providing a solid foundation for future growth and operations.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and other heavy-use surfaces on business properties.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material, often reinforced with steel to support heavy loads and ensure durability.
How thick should a commercial slab be? Thickness varies based on the project, but common commercial slabs range from 4 to 6 inches to accommodate different load requirements.
What should property owners consider before construction? Proper site preparation, soil conditions, and intended use are important factors to ensure the slab performs well over time.
